The International Road Federation was founded in 1948 with a mission to promote the exchange of best practices and the transfer of technologies from those who have it to those who need it. Seven decades later, this mission remains just as relevant, and at a time when many transportation professionals are unable to travel, IRF is redoubling efforts to develop eLearning programs which allow professionals to access a pool of knowledge resources without the need to travel.
Al-Mohsen Engineering in Qatar is one of the country’s leading specialists for the supply of aggregates to major construction companies. The firm is currently producing materials for many of Qatar’s infrastructure projects. Al-Mohsen is now a major player in the construction segment thanks to its ability to supply large volumes of high-quality aggregates to the market. Liebherr and the Russian company Kamaz have signed a contract to develop and manufacture a range of six-cylinder diesel engines with 12litre displacement. The engines are tailored by Liebherr to meet specific requirements from Kamaz.
At the same time, the contract includes a complete solution for the construction of an engine production and assembly line as well as respective quality assurance within Kamaz's production.
